The two conducting rails in the drawing are tilted upwards so theyeach make an angle of 30.0° with respect to the ground. The vertical magnetic field has a magnitude of 0.045 T. The 0.22 kg aluminumrod (length = 1.6 m) slides without friction down the rails at aconstant velocity. How much current flows through the rod?
